What to do if succulent plants grow too tall to become trees (How to control the growth of succulent plants and make them into old piles with multiple heads)

What is the solution for growing succulent seedlings?

【1】Increasing light and controlling water are the top priorities

If you find that succulents have a tendency to grow too tall, fade, or spread out during daily maintenance, you should increase light and control watering to prevent their condition from further deteriorating. This is also to solve the problem from the source and fundamentally.

Because of the early excessive growth, fading and spreading, as long as the branches have not been obviously elongated, they can actually recover after a period of control and care.

【2】Proper treatment can make leggy growth irreversible

If the succulent plant has already grown seriously, you may consider controlling the cliff pile or removing the bottom leaves to make it a "pseudo old pile" based on the characteristics of the variety and the needs of reproduction. We can also cut the head to make it sprout side buds, or even use leaf cuttings to reproduce and regenerate.

Remedies for Lean Growth of Succulent Plants

【1】Build cliff piles

For some leggy seedlings that are easy to grow branches and have good branch toughness, you can wait until their branches are in a semi-lignified state, remove some of the bottom-layer leaves, and use horticultural wire, gravity traction, inverted pots, etc. to make them grow in the direction of cliff piles.

Varieties like Purple Music, Jelly Maiden Heart, Dance with Grace, Crispy Duck, Allen, Thin Makeup, Pansy, etc., are more ornamental after being grown into cliff piles than ordinary old piles.

【2】Cut the head and produce side shoots

For some varieties with severe excessive branch growth, the apical dominance can be broken by beheading, which can encourage the growth of side buds.

After most Crassulaceae succulents are beheaded, the buds on the branches will soon sprout again. Moreover, the upper leaf discs of the beheaded plants can be dried and then used for cuttings, and the scattered leaves can also be used for leaf cuttings.

【3】Pulling leaves turns into "old piles"

Most leggy succulents will have branches that grow rapidly and leaves that are scattered.

At this time, you only need to remove some of the scattered leaves at the bottom of the branches, and then slowly make the branches lignify by controlling water and increasing light, and it can be transformed into a "small old stump".

However, this kind of old stump that has grown too long is not as graceful as the natural old stump that has been left to grow over time. There will be some scars and uneven thickness on the branches.

【4】Pick leaves and plant them

For most varieties whose leaves can be completely peeled off, leaf cuttings can be attempted as long as they have intact growth points, so leggy succulents can also be propagated by peeling off their leaves and using leaf cuttings.

Through leaf cuttings propagation, not only can you produce leaf cutting seedlings in batches, but you can also produce double-headed, variegated and variegated seedlings with a certain probability. It just takes a relatively long time and requires a certain amount of patience.
